Schools and educational services, nec, nec
The University of Sydney Confucius Institute
The University of Sydney, located in Darlington, New South Wales, is recognized as one of the leading institutions in education and research, consistently ranking high both nationally and globally. With over 150 research centres and networks, it aims to address critical global challenges, including sustainability and public health.
This prestigious university offers a diverse range of courses across various faculties, including architecture, business, law, and the sciences. It fosters an innovative academic environment where researchers and students collaborate to tackle pressing societal issues. Generated from the website